32609578 has 4 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 48914370. Its totient is φ = 16304788.
The previous prime is 32609569. The next prime is 32609579. The reversal of 32609578 is 87590623.
It is a semiprime because it is the product of two primes.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 26040609 + 6568969 = 5103^2 + 2563^2 .
It is a Smith number, since the sum of its digits (40) coincides with the sum of the digits of its prime factors. Since it is squarefree, it is also a hoax number.
It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 32609578.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(32609579)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(13)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 8152393 + ... + 8152396.
Almost surely, 232609578 is an apocalyptic number.
32609578 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(16304792).
32609578 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
32609578 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 16304791.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 90720, while the sum is 40.
The square root of 32609578 is about 5710.4796646166. The cubic root of 32609578 is about 319.4834700741.
The spelling of 32609578 in words is "thirty-two million, six hundred nine thousand, five hundred seventy-eight".
